Exactly what is a Help Coordinator?
A Guidance Coordinator is a professional who assists NDIS members in being familiar with and utilizing their NDIS programs. They assist members connect with support suppliers, coordinate many supports, and build the capability to handle their unique supports independently. The final word purpose is to empower participants to create knowledgeable choices and obtain their particular aims.
Vital Tasks of the Aid Coordinator
Aid Coordinators undertake An array of responsibilities to be certain contributors acquire the mandatory assist:
Knowledge the NDIS System: They help contributors comprehend the small print in their NDIS strategies, which include budgets, guidance classes, and the way to employ funding properly.
Connecting with Services Companies: Aid Coordinators help in identifying and connecting participants with acceptable provider suppliers that align with their demands and preferences.
Coordinating Supports: They make certain that all products and services and supports are Performing cohesively, steering clear of duplication and addressing any service gaps.
Creating Capability: Assist Coordinators work with individuals to establish expertise and self confidence to handle their supports independently over time.
Crisis Administration: In circumstances in which members experience unforeseen troubles, Support Coordinators enable navigate and mitigate these challenges promptly.
Monitoring and Reporting: They keep an eye on the efficiency of supports and supply required studies for the Nationwide Incapacity Insurance coverage Agency (NDIA) as necessary.
Levels of Help Coordination
The NDIS recognizes three levels of assistance imp source coordination, Just about every catering to distinctive participant requirements:
Assist Link: check it out This amount concentrates on making the participant's power to connect with informal, Neighborhood, and funded supports, enabling them to obtain the most out of their prepare.
Assistance Coordination: At this stage, the Support Coordinator assists in building and employing a mixture of supports, serving to the participant to Are living extra independently and be A part of click site the community.
Expert Support Coordination: This is for members with far more complicated requirements. Expert Assist Coordinators assistance handle problems within the guidance atmosphere and assure reliable company supply.
